Axial tilt, also called obliquity, refers to the angle a planet’s rotation axis makes with the plane of its orbit. The Earth is currently tilted 23.5° from this plane, resulting in many …

WebAnswer (1 of 8): The earth’s axis makes an angle of 66½° with its orbital plane and 23½° with the perpendicular line to the orbital plane.

It tells us that the Earth's spin axis is tilted with respect to the plane of the Earth's solar orbit by 23.5°. Observations show that the other planets, with the exception of Pluto, also orbit the sun in essentially the same plane.
